{"data":{"id":"us-ut/utah-code-70d-3-204","jurisdiction":"us-ut","citation":"Utah Code § 70D-3-204","heading":"Renewal of license.","body":"(1) A license issued under this chapter expires on December 31 of each year.\n(2) To qualify to renew a license under this chapter an individual shall:\n(a) meet the requirements of Section 70D-3-202; and\n(b) complete the annual continuing education requirements of Section 70D-3-303.\n(3) To renew a license under this chapter an individual shall:\n(a) file an application with the commissioner in a form prescribed by the commissioner in rule;\n(b) demonstrate that the individual continues to meet the requirements related to the nationwide database under 12 U.S.C. Sec. 5104;\n(c) demonstrate completion of the continuing education requirements; and\n(d) notwithstanding the requirements applicable to a regulatory fee under Section 63J-1-504, pay a fee of $100.","path":["Title 70D Financial Institution Mortgage Financing Regulation Act","Chapter 70D-3 Financial Institution Loan Originator Licensing Act","Part 70D-3-2 Licensing Requirements and Procedures"],"source_url":"https://le.utah.gov/xcode/Title70D/Chapter3/70D-3-S204.html","current_through":"2026 General Session","vintage":"","retrieved_at":"2026-09-03T11:34:34Z","sha256":"d7872149a4f3baa93a2b89f5bfa80da199ad05b66c519f02c8a0742a8707546a","source_id":"us-ut","stale":false,"prev":"us-ut/utah-code-70d-3-203","next":"us-ut/utah-code-70d-3-205"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
